Our North Country Café Menu now offers a “Well Being” option.
This option provides customers a daily meal choice each day that falls within certain nutritional guidelines. Well Being is our comprehensive nutrition education and dining program. We use a balanced approach that includes your preferences and the latest nutrition research.
Our menu icon ( ) makes it easy for you to identify choices within the Well Being brand.
This icon will highlight a featured meal (entrée and two sides) with fewer than 550 calories, less than 15 grams of fat, and at least 2 -3 grams of fiber.
This meal will come at a special combo price
(no substitutions)
You will receive a punch card for Well Being purchases. Each Well Being meal will earn one punch on your card. After 10 punches on this card, you will receive a free Well Being meal.

Nutritional Information
Hot entrée signage in the North Country Café still includes calories, grams of fat, carbohydrates and milligrams of sodium for reference.
Example: Beef Noodle Soup 180/6/22/350
This means the Beef Noodle Soup contains 180 calories, 6 grams of fat, 22 grams of carbohydrates, and 250 milligrams of sodium. |
